Solution JachuPL 308 Posted April 5, 2015 Solution Share Posted April 5, 2015 On start, game sends packet to DB HEADER_GD_BOOT or sth like that. DB collects all the necessary data, pack it and returns to game. Game gets initialized with data get from DB and it launches. If the data is wrong, game shuts down. For a player, your client sends HEADER_CG_LOGIN3 packet to game. Game forwards this packet to DB. DB gets the packet, selects all the data from table (look for QUERY_PLAYER_LOAD or sth like that) and returns it to game.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
